What is wrong with all those webhost with their uptime guarantees, sure it is nice if your webhost is giving you a 99.9% uptime guarantee, but what does this mean, and how are they calculating this number. And not less important, do you want your webhost to go bankrupt because of a bad monday ?

Okay, I take it that a bad monday would not bring a decent company to the ground, but servers need to be payed, if they where online or offline. This is where things get interesting.

Bottom line, when a host offers you a 99.9% uptime, ask them about their refund policy, how to get the refund when their server did go down, who is deciding what happened (external monitoring company, or the host themselves), and how they make clear they are going to have scheduled maintenance on your server. But do not expect any host to deliver a high uptime for a low budget.

Some applications open a popup to fill in some information, when you are using firefox this not always goes the way you want, making is impossible, or nearly impossible to fill in the data, especially if you are not able to resize the window.

To make sure you can ALWAYS resize the windows you can do the following:

Start firefox and type in the URL bar: about:config
This will open the configuration window, now type there:

dom.disable_window_open_feature.resizable
And set the value to: true, and you are ready to go!

Searching for a freeware tool, which has it all ? look no further, PSPAD has it all, well, i think it has, up-till now i found everything i really wanted.

From a simple text editor with strong search&replace functionality, to selecting text in columns instead of lines. It also got a build in FTP editor, and to many features to all name them here. One word, PSPAD got it all, and if not, there are several add-on modules downloadable from the website.

As the writer says, this program is for any one who likes to:

- Work with various programming environments
- Like highlighted syntax in their source code
- Need a small tool with simple controls and the capabilities of a mighty       code editor
- Are looking for a tool that handles plain text
- Want to save money and still have the functionality of professional products.

I think they are to humble for describing their own software, a must try!
